WebbIn 1888 Fridtjof Nansen, together with five companions, became the first to cross Greenland’s inland. They spent six weeks skiing across the ice cap from east to west and had to spend the winter 1888-89 at Godthaab (Nuuk) on the west coast before they could get a ship back to Norway. I would like to express my sincere gratitude to the … fishing in the waccamaw river scWebb25 feb. 2024 · Greenland is divided into 5 municipalities (kommuner, sing. kommune). In alphabetical order, these municipalities are: Avannaata, Kujalleq, Qeqertalik, Qeqqata and Sermersooq.
